"Great restaurant! Food and service are outstanding!"
Phone: +17704270490
Address: 2710 Canton Road, Kennesaw, 30066, United States Of America
City: Kennesaw
Tuesday: 16:00-22:00
Wednesday: 16:00-22:00
Thursday: 16:00-22:00
Friday: 16:00-22:00 16:00-23:00
Saturday: 16:00-22:00 16:00-23:00
Sunday: 16:00-22:00
Dishes: 81
Amenities: 25
Categories: 5
Reviews: 2478